Moorish Style Overmantel Attributed to Liberty & Co

19th century
Description

A rare Liberty & Co attributed Moorish style walnut overmantel probably designed by Leonard Wyburd (1865 – 1958). Wyburd was the head of Liberty’s Furnishing and Decoration Studio from its foundation in 1883 until he left in 1903 to establish his own studio in Wigmore Street, London.

Similar “Moresque” style overmantels are featured on page 67 of Liberty’s Handbook of Sketches (1889).

Source: Daryl Bennett: Liberty’s Furniture 1875 – 1915: The Birth of Modern Interior Design, Antique Collectors’ Club, 2012, page 33.

Circa 1890.

Moorish Revival furniture originated in the late 19th century, inspired by Islamic architecture, North African woodwork, and Middle Eastern design. Popularised by retailers such as Liberty & Co, these pieces frequently incorporate horseshoe arches, lattice spindle work, and tiered display shelves.

These items are typically constructed from solid hardwoods such as oak or walnut, featuring turned spindle galleries, carved brackets, and hand-joined panelling framing a central silvered mirror plate.

Authentic period examples exhibit hand-carved architectural detailing, natural timber ageing, original backing boards, and traditional joinery such as mortise and tenon joints without modern hidden screws or synthetic adhesives.

An overmantel mirror can be mounted directly above a fireplace, console table, or hallway sideboard to create a focal point. Combining dark wood frames with contemporary neutral walls highlights the architectural shadow lines and intricate fretwork.

Dust the woodwork regularly using a dry microfibre cloth and apply a high-quality beeswax polish annually to protect the original finish. Avoid using harsh chemical sprays directly on the glass or surrounding timber to prevent moisture ingress and wood damage.
